What is an international business
manager?
International business managers plan, organize, delegate and control
entire projects from start to finish for businesses and
organizations with international connections. International business
managers supply the encouragement, the coordination and the
leadership to achieve company goals in differing cultural and
governmental situations. Given the globalization of our economy,
this job position holds much promise as a fast-growing management
specialty area.
What types of skills are required?
Skills in leadership, creativity, communication, human relations,
marketing, organizational development, accounting and economics are
required. In addition, knowledge of languages, cultural diversity,
governmental systems and logistics all factor into this position.
Where are they employed?
International business managers may work in administrative and
managerial capacities for a variety of organizations and businesses
with international connections both in this hemisphere and overseas.

What is the salary range?
Locally, the starting salary range is $17,000 to $24,000 per year.
Internationally, these professionals can expect annual earnings
starting at $20,000 and increasing to as much as $150,000+ with
experience.
